For Malaysian users, no casino feature is more important than safety. Attractive graphics, large welcome packages, and a deep game library cannot compensate for an operator that might disappear overnight. The first protective step is to confirm a verifiable gambling licence before creating an account or transferring money. Authorities frequently cited in the international market include the Malta Gaming Authority, the UKGC, and the relevant Curacao regulator, all of which impose some form click here of compliance standards. Licensing can provide greater formal supervision, and regulated casinos may have obligations concerning the separation of customer balances from ordinary company expenses. Website security matters just as much, so check that the casino uses SSL technology when handling identity details, passwords, and banking information. A secure connection reduces the chance that sensitive data will be exposed while travelling between your device and the platform. A casino that keeps its regulatory credentials or encryption standards hidden should be treated as a reason to walk away.

The final question is not whether an online casino can provide excitement, but whether the user can leave with individual controls intact. Spending and time boundaries ought to be decided while the mind is calm. After play starts, the original limits should not move. Hidden behaviour, borrowing, missed obligations, repeated recovery bets, and conflict with family are serious signals. Emotional states matter because anger, stress, loneliness, alcohol, and funds worries can transform a planned gaming visit into an impulsive one. If casino participation no longer feels voluntary, the person should step away, restrict access, and seek help from someone trustworthy or professionally qualified. The digital lobby can sparkle like a midnight carnival, but flashing lights cannot pay back peace of mind. When serious warning signs appear, the safest response is to stop, block access where possible, and seek support.
